Fritha Goodey
Fritha Jane Goodey (23 October 1972 – 7 September 2004) was a British stage, radio and film actress known for her performance in the film '' About a Boy'' (2002), in which she played one of Hugh Grant's character's former girlfriends. Early life Goodey was born in Kingston upon Thames, Surrey, and trained at the London Academy of Music and Dramatic Art. Career Goodey's stage work, most notably with Max Stafford-Clark's Out of Joint touring company, included Nadia in ''Some Explicit Polaroids'' (1999), Odette in '' Remembrance of Things Past'' (2000), Constance Neville in ''She Stoops to Conquer'' (2002) and Mrs. Garrick in ''A Laughing Matter''. She had recently won a coveted role in a revival staging of Terence Rattigan's '' Man and Boy''. Her radio works include '' The Further Adventures of Sherlock Holmes'' episode '' The Determined Client'' and Helena Justina in the serialisation of the Falco novel '' The Silver Pigs''. Erica Baneth-Goodey
Erica Marianna Baneth, née Foti, (1928– ) by 1968 known as Erica Baneth-Goodey, was an Australian sculptor, born in Budapest, Hungary. History Baneth was born in Budapest, Hungary, and emigrated to Australia in 1948. She studied at Royal Melbourne Institute of Technology 1955–1959, Canberra Institute of Technology 1959–1962, National Gallery of Victoria (part time) 1963, Hammersmith School of Architecture and Arts 1966. She taught at Monash University University in 1968, and around this time became known as Baneth-Goodey. She married in 1977 and emigrated to Los Angeles.
